The School of Chemical Engineering is committed to teaching as well as research-development and innovation. Our chemical faculty teams are always trying to focus on research and collaborative activities with institutes/organisation to provide valuable platforms for exchange of ideas/technology. The primary objectives can be summarized as:
- To motivate faculty for doctoral and post-doctoral studies at various National and International universities and organizations of repute.
- To initiate research projects in, thrust areas of engineering funded by various National and International agencies.
- To develop interaction and collaboration between researchers for interdisciplinary and multidisciplinary work.
- To explore new horizons of knowledge and ensuring its practical implementation through collective efforts and quality research work.
- To provide adequate facilities, resources, and environment conducive for research work.
- To support the faculties for consulting research project/work from MIT- Alumni’s, Govt. research organizations such as CSIR-NCL, Pune and ICT, Mumbai.
- To provide the assistance/guidance of faculty member/s in product/process modification, modernization, trouble shooting, etc from chemical industries. These industries may also provide training/assistance to faculty and staff for curriculum enrichment.
The faculty at School of Chemical Engineering are involved in cutting edge research that can have a positive influence on the life of mankind. The concerted efforts of faculty are manifested in the form of completing a number of research projects funded by University of Pune, AICTE and Department of Atomic Energy, Govt. of India.
